Concrete stairs installation involves constructing durable and functional staircases using high-quality concrete materials. This service typically includes designing the staircase layout, preparing the site, pouring and shaping the concrete, and finishing the surface for safety and aesthetics. Whether building new stairs or replacing existing ones, this process ensures a sturdy structure that can withstand daily use and harsh weather conditions, providing a safe and reliable access point to different levels of a property.
This service helps solve common problems such as uneven, cracked, or deteriorating stairs that can pose safety hazards or reduce curb appeal. It is also useful for addressing issues related to aging concrete steps, such as crumbling edges or unstable footing. By installing new concrete stairs, property owners can improve accessibility, prevent accidents, and enhance the overall appearance of their property’s exterior, whether at the front entrance, backyard, or side yard.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Stairs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ete stair repairs gener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or resurfacing jobs fall within this band,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age.
Standard Installation - Installing new concrete stairs for a standard residential project often cost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in this range are straightforward replacements or additions, with fewer reaching higher costs.
Custom Designs - Custom or decorative concrete stairs with unique finishes or complex designs can range from $3,000 to $6,000. Larger or more intricate projects tend to push costs into the higher end of this spectrum.
Full Replacement - Replacing an existing set of stairs entirely typically costs between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more complex projects, such as those involving extensive site work or structural changes, can exceed this range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ete stairs can local contractors install? Local contractors can install various types of concrete stairs, including straight, spiral, and custom-designed options to suit different property styles and needs.
Are there different finishes available for concrete stairs? Yes, service providers offer a range of finishes such as stamped, textured, or polished surfaces to enhance the appearance and durability of concrete stairs.
Can local contractors handle both indoor and outdoor concrete stairs? Absolutely, local service providers are experienced in installing concrete stairs for both interior and exterior applications, ensuring proper installation for each setting.
What preparation is needed before installing concrete stairs? Preparation typically involves site assessment, ensuring proper footing, and clearing the area to facilitate a smooth installation process handled by local contractors.
How do local pros ensure the safety and stability of concrete stairs? They follow best practices for reinforcement, proper slope, and finishing techniques to ensure the stairs are safe, stable, and long-lasting.
